Background & History of The Name Dai

The name 'Dai' has its origins in various cultures and languages. In Welsh, the name 'Dai' is a diminutive form of 'Dafydd,' the Welsh equivalent of the name 'David.' This name has been popular in Wales for centuries and continues to be used today. In Japanese, 'Dai' can be a given name or a surname and has different meanings depending on the kanji characters used to write it. One possible meaning is 'big' or 'great.' In Chinese, the name 'Dai' is a surname, most commonly found in the southern regions of China. The Dai people, an ethnic group in China, Laos, Thailand, and Myanmar, share the same name as their surname. The surname 'Dai' in China is among the top 100 surnames, with a long history that can be traced back thousands of years.

Throughout history, individuals named 'Dai' have made significant contributions to various fields. For example, Dai Vernon (1894-1992) was a renowned Canadian magician known as "The Professor" for his expert knowledge and skill in close-up magic. His innovative techniques and teachings have greatly influenced the art of magic worldwide. Additionally, Dai Qingying is a Chinese artist celebrated for her exquisite landscape and flower paintings. Her delicate brushwork and attention to detail have earned her recognition and acclaim both in China and internationally.
